30-year-old John Gregory was involved in a car accident late Christmas Eve at Music Valley Drive near Logan’s Roadhouse. Officers arrived and spoke with Gregory, who was visibly intoxicated, and gave them two different stories regarding how the accident occurred. He consented to sobriety tests, performed poorly, and admitted to having an alcoholic beverage earlier in the day under Miranda. He was taken into custody for driving under the influence and implied consent on Christmas Day.

John M. Gregory of Emerald Bay Blvd in Whites Creek, TN, was booked into the Metro Nashville Jail on December 25th, charged with DUI and implied consent. A judicial commissioner set his bond at $2,500, and the Davidson County Sheriff’s Office gave him pre-trial release from their facility.
